Home
last modified time | relevance | path

Searched refs:sb (Results 1 – 25 of 51) sorted by relevance

123

/php-src/ext/fileinfo/libmagic/
H A Dfsmagic.c100 ret = php_sys_stat(fn, sb); in file_fsmagic()
116 if (sb->st_mode & S_ISUID) in file_fsmagic()
121 if (sb->st_mode & S_ISGID) in file_fsmagic()
126 if (sb->st_mode & S_ISVTX) in file_fsmagic()
132 switch (sb->st_mode & S_IFMT) { in file_fsmagic()
152 COMMA, major(sb->st_rdev), dv_unit(sb->st_rdev), in file_fsmagic()
153 dv_subunit(sb->st_rdev)) == -1) in file_fsmagic()
157 COMMA, (long)major(sb->st_rdev), in file_fsmagic()
158 (long)minor(sb->st_rdev)) == -1) in file_fsmagic()
227 if ((ms->flags & MAGIC_DEVICES) == 0 && sb->st_size == 0) { in file_fsmagic()
[all …]
H A Dmagic.c200 zend_stat_t sb = {0}; in file_or_stream() local
215 switch (file_fsmagic(ms, inname, &sb)) { in file_or_stream()
231 if (unreadable_info(ms, sb.st_mode, inname) == -1) in file_or_stream()
246 memcpy(&sb, &ssb.sb, sizeof(zend_stat_t)); in file_or_stream()
257 if (file_buffer(ms, stream, &sb, inname, buf, CAST(size_t, nbytes)) == -1) in file_or_stream()
H A Dapprentice.c1082 size_t sb = file_magic_strength(mb->mp, mb->cont_count); in apprentice_sort() local
1083 if (sa == sb) in apprentice_sort()
1085 else if (sa > sb) in apprentice_sort()
3233 if (st.sb.st_mode & S_IFDIR) { in apprentice_map()
3255 if (st.sb.st_size < 8 || st.sb.st_size > maxoff_t()) { in apprentice_map()
3257 st.sb.st_size < 8 ? "small" : "large"); in apprentice_map()
3262 map->len = CAST(size_t, st.sb.st_size); in apprentice_map()
3265 if (php_stream_read(stream, map->p, (size_t)st.sb.st_size) != (size_t)st.sb.st_size) { in apprentice_map()
3303 nentries = (uint32_t)(st.sb.st_size / sizeof(struct magic)); in apprentice_map()
3304 entries = (uint32_t)(st.sb.st_size / sizeof(struct magic)); in apprentice_map()
[all …]
/php-src/ext/zip/
H A Dzip_stream.c123 struct zip_stat sb; in php_zip_ops_stat() local
175 ssb->sb.st_size = sb.size; in php_zip_ops_stat()
178 ssb->sb.st_size = 0; in php_zip_ops_stat()
182 ssb->sb.st_mtime = sb.mtime; in php_zip_ops_stat()
183 ssb->sb.st_atime = sb.mtime; in php_zip_ops_stat()
184 ssb->sb.st_ctime = sb.mtime; in php_zip_ops_stat()
185 ssb->sb.st_nlink = 1; in php_zip_ops_stat()
186 ssb->sb.st_rdev = -1; in php_zip_ops_stat()
188 ssb->sb.st_blksize = -1; in php_zip_ops_stat()
189 ssb->sb.st_blocks = -1; in php_zip_ops_stat()
[all …]
H A Dphp_zip.c128 struct zip_stat sb; in php_zip_extract_file() local
1980 struct zip_stat sb; local
1991 RETURN_SB(&sb);
2002 struct zip_stat sb; local
2014 RETURN_SB(&sb);
2198 struct zip_stat sb; local
2261 struct zip_stat sb; local
2326 struct zip_stat sb; local
2450 struct zip_stat sb; local
2912 if (sb.size < 1) {
[all …]
H A Dphp_zip.h62 struct zip_stat sb; member
92 php_stream *php_stream_zip_open(struct zip *arch, struct zip_stat *sb, const char *mode, zip_flags_…
/php-src/ext/zip/tests/
H A Doo_delete.phpt57 $sb = $zip->statIndex(0);
58 var_dump($sb);
59 $sb = $zip->statIndex(1);
60 var_dump($sb);
61 $sb = $zip->statIndex(2);
62 var_dump($sb);
H A Doo_addglob2.phpt49 $sb = $zip->statIndex($i);
50 echo "$i: " . $sb['name'] .
51 ", comp=" . $sb['comp_method'] .
52 ", enc=" . $sb['encryption_method'] . "\n";
H A Dutils.inc4 $sb = $z->statIndex($i);
5 echo $i . ' ' . $sb['name'] . "\n";
H A Dbug7658.phpt41 $sb = $zip->statIndex($i);
42 $found[] = $sb['name'];
/php-src/ext/phar/
H A Dfunc_interceptors.c492 zend_stat_t sb = {0}; in phar_file_stat() local
543 sb.st_size = 0; in phar_file_stat()
544 sb.st_mode = 0777; in phar_file_stat()
583 sb.st_size = 0; in phar_file_stat()
616 sb.st_size = 0; in phar_file_stat()
630 sb.st_mode = (sb.st_mode & 0555) | (sb.st_mode & ~0777); in phar_file_stat()
633 sb.st_nlink = 1; in phar_file_stat()
634 sb.st_rdev = -1; in phar_file_stat()
636 sb.st_dev = 0xc; in phar_file_stat()
642 sb.st_blksize = -1; in phar_file_stat()
[all …]
H A Dstream.c503 ssb->sb.st_mtime = data->timestamp; in phar_dostat()
507 ssb->sb.st_size = 0; in phar_dostat()
515 ssb->sb.st_size = 0; in phar_dostat()
516 ssb->sb.st_mode = 0777; in phar_dostat()
523 ssb->sb.st_mode = (ssb->sb.st_mode & 0555) | (ssb->sb.st_mode & ~0777); in phar_dostat()
526 ssb->sb.st_nlink = 1; in phar_dostat()
527 ssb->sb.st_rdev = -1; in phar_dostat()
529 ssb->sb.st_dev = 0xc; in phar_dostat()
532 ssb->sb.st_ino = data->inode; in phar_dostat()
535 ssb->sb.st_blksize = -1; in phar_dostat()
[all …]
/php-src/ext/dom/tests/
H A DDOMXPath_quote.phpt33 $sb = [];
39 $sb[] = $quoteMethod . \substr($string, 0, $bytesUntilQuote) . $quoteMethod;
42 $sb = \implode(',', $sb);
43 return 'concat(' . $sb . ')';
/php-src/ext/standard/
H A Dftp_fopen_wrapper.c792 ssb->sb.st_mode |= S_IFREG; in php_stream_ftp_url_stat()
812 ssb->sb.st_size = 0; in php_stream_ftp_url_stat()
861 ssb->sb.st_mtime = -1; in php_stream_ftp_url_stat()
865 ssb->sb.st_dev = 0; in php_stream_ftp_url_stat()
866 ssb->sb.st_uid = 0; in php_stream_ftp_url_stat()
867 ssb->sb.st_gid = 0; in php_stream_ftp_url_stat()
868 ssb->sb.st_atime = -1; in php_stream_ftp_url_stat()
869 ssb->sb.st_ctime = -1; in php_stream_ftp_url_stat()
871 ssb->sb.st_nlink = 1; in php_stream_ftp_url_stat()
872 ssb->sb.st_rdev = -1; in php_stream_ftp_url_stat()
[all …]
H A Dlink.c95 zend_stat_t sb = {0}; in PHP_FUNCTION() local
110 ret = VCWD_LSTAT(link, &sb); in PHP_FUNCTION()
118 RETURN_LONG((zend_long) sb.st_dev); in PHP_FUNCTION()
H A Diptc.c181 zend_stat_t sb = {0}; in PHP_FUNCTION() local
206 if (zend_fstat(fileno(fp), &sb) != 0) { in PHP_FUNCTION()
210 spoolbuf = zend_string_safe_alloc(1, iptcdata_len + sizeof(psheader) + 1024 + 1, sb.st_size, 0); in PHP_FUNCTION()
212 memset(poi, 0, iptcdata_len + sizeof(psheader) + sb.st_size + 1024 + 1); in PHP_FUNCTION()
H A Dfile.c1409 ZVAL_LONG(&stat_dev, stat_ssb.sb.st_dev); in php_fstat()
1410 ZVAL_LONG(&stat_ino, stat_ssb.sb.st_ino); in php_fstat()
1411 ZVAL_LONG(&stat_mode, stat_ssb.sb.st_mode); in php_fstat()
1413 ZVAL_LONG(&stat_uid, stat_ssb.sb.st_uid); in php_fstat()
1414 ZVAL_LONG(&stat_gid, stat_ssb.sb.st_gid); in php_fstat()
1416 ZVAL_LONG(&stat_rdev, stat_ssb.sb.st_rdev); in php_fstat()
1420 ZVAL_LONG(&stat_size, stat_ssb.sb.st_size); in php_fstat()
1542 if (S_ISDIR(src_s.sb.st_mode)) { in php_copy_file_ctx()
1557 if (S_ISDIR(dest_s.sb.st_mode)) { in php_copy_file_ctx()
1561 if (!src_s.sb.st_ino || !dest_s.sb.st_ino) { in php_copy_file_ctx()
[all …]
/php-src/win32/
H A Dglob.c531 zend_stat_t sb = {0}; in glob2() local
542 if (g_lstat(pathbuf, &sb, pglob)) in glob2()
546 !IS_SLASH(pathend[-1])) && (S_ISDIR(sb.st_mode) || in glob2()
547 (S_ISLNK(sb.st_mode) && in glob2()
548 (g_stat(pathbuf, &sb, pglob) == 0) && in glob2()
549 S_ISDIR(sb.st_mode)))) { in glob2()
816 return((*pglob->gl_lstat)(buf, sb)); in g_lstat()
817 return(php_sys_lstat(buf, sb)); in g_lstat()
820 static int g_stat(Char *fn, zend_stat_t *sb, glob_t *pglob) in g_stat() argument
827 return((*pglob->gl_stat)(buf, sb)); in g_stat()
[all …]
/php-src/main/streams/
H A Dplain_wrapper.c158 zend_stat_t sb; member
169 r = zend_fstat(fd, &d->sb); in do_fstat()
258 self->is_seekable = !(S_ISFIFO(self->sb.st_mode) || S_ISCHR(self->sb.st_mode)); in detect_is_seekable()
664 memcpy(&ssb->sb, &data->sb, sizeof(ssb->sb)); in php_stdiop_stat()
1231 return VCWD_LSTAT(url, &ssb->sb); in php_plain_files_url_stater()
1236 return VCWD_LSTAT(url, &ssb->sb); in php_plain_files_url_stater()
1240 return VCWD_STAT(url, &ssb->sb); in php_plain_files_url_stater()
1306 zend_stat_t sb; in php_plain_files_rename() local
1323 if (VCWD_CHOWN(url_to, sb.st_uid, sb.st_gid)) { in php_plain_files_rename()
1392 zend_stat_t sb; in php_plain_files_mkdir() local
[all …]
H A Dmemory.c198 ssb->sb.st_size = ZSTR_LEN(ms->data); in php_stream_memory_stat()
199 ssb->sb.st_mode |= S_IFREG; /* regular file */ in php_stream_memory_stat()
200 ssb->sb.st_mtime = timestamp; in php_stream_memory_stat()
201 ssb->sb.st_atime = timestamp; in php_stream_memory_stat()
202 ssb->sb.st_ctime = timestamp; in php_stream_memory_stat()
203 ssb->sb.st_nlink = 1; in php_stream_memory_stat()
204 ssb->sb.st_rdev = -1; in php_stream_memory_stat()
206 ssb->sb.st_dev = 0xC; in php_stream_memory_stat()
208 ssb->sb.st_ino = 0; in php_stream_memory_stat()
211 ssb->sb.st_blksize = -1; in php_stream_memory_stat()
[all …]
/php-src/ext/fileinfo/
H A Dlibmagic.patch624 + if (st.sb.st_size < 8 || st.sb.st_size > maxoff_t()) {
661 + if (php_stream_read(stream, map->p, (size_t)st.sb.st_size) != (size_t)st.sb.st_size) {
1644 - ret = lstat(fn, sb);
1660 - sb->st_mode = S_IFBLK;
1730 COMMA, major(sb->st_rdev), dv_unit(sb->st_rdev),
1758 - COMMA, major(sb->st_rdev), dv_unit(sb->st_rdev),
2483 - const struct stat *sb)
2548 - struct stat sb;
2549 + zend_stat_t sb = {0};
2589 - sb.st_mode = S_IFBLK;
[all …]
H A Dfileinfo.c393 if (ssb.sb.st_mode & S_IFDIR) { in _php_finfo_get_type()
408 if (ssb.sb.st_mode & S_IFDIR) { in _php_finfo_get_type()
/php-src/main/
H A Dphp_ini.c635 zend_stat_t sb = {0}; in php_init_config() local
676 if (VCWD_STAT(ini_file, &sb) == 0) { in php_init_config()
677 if (S_ISREG(sb.st_mode)) { in php_init_config()
761 zend_stat_t sb = {0}; in php_parse_user_ini_file() local
766 if (VCWD_STAT(ini_file, &sb) == 0) { in php_parse_user_ini_file()
767 if (S_ISREG(sb.st_mode)) { in php_parse_user_ini_file()
/php-src/ext/mysqli/tests/bind_insert/
H A Dsend_long_data.phpt22 mysqli_stmt_bind_param($stmt, "sb", $c1, $c2);
/php-src/ext/standard/tests/strings/
H A Dstrval_variation2.phpt18 $sb = "\xb0\xb1\xb2\xb3\xb4\xb5\xb6\xb7\xb8\xb9\xba\xbb\xbc\xbd\xbe\xbf";
46 echo bin2hex(strval($sb));

Completed in 107 milliseconds

123